linux安装oracle客户端

下载客户端软件

客户端下载地址

1
2
链接:https://pan.baidu.com/s/1StXjSjQ_6wRuwj4tewRlaA
提取码:8ynu

 sqlldr工具

链接:https://pan.baidu.com/s/1ZmGSY0ECliLhY5s6FXBNeA 
提取码:8iab

plsql工具

链接:https://pan.baidu.com/s/1v8F-uR7X923qTy8SULHbEg 
提取码:e2an

将软件上传至服务器,进入软件目录执行安装

rpm -ivh oracle-instantclient18.5-basic-18.5.0.0.0-3.x86_64.rpm
rpm -ivh oracle-instantclient18.5-sqlplus-18.5.0.0.0-3.x86_64.rpm
rpm -ivh oracle-instantclient18.5-tools-18.5.0.0.0-3.x86_64.rpm

配置环境变量

复制代码
vi /etc/profile

PATH=$PATH:$HOME/bin
export ORACLE_HOME=/usr/lib/oracle/18.5/client64
export ORACLE_BASE=/usr/lib/oracle/18.5/
export TNS_ADMIN=$ORACLE_HOME/network/admin
export LD_LIBRARY_PATH=$ORACLE_HOME/lib:$LD_LIBRARY_PATH
PATH=$PATH:$HOME/bin:$ORACLE_HOME/bin
export PATH

source /etc/profile
复制代码

配置监听

复制代码
vi  $ORACLE_HOME/network/admin/tnsnames.ora

lol_114 = 

  (DESCRIPTION =

    (ADDRESS_LIST =

      (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.101.114)(PORT = 1521))

    )

    (CONNECT_DATA =

      (SERVER = DEDICATED)

      (SERVICE_NAME = orcl)

    )

  )
复制代码

报如下错误:

sqlplus: error while loading shared libraries: libnsl.so.1: cannot open shared object file: No such file or directory

yum install libnsl.x86_64

连接测试

sqlplus tuser/123456@192.168.101.114:1521/orcl

 

posted @   幸福在靠近  阅读(915)  评论(0编辑  收藏  举报
相关博文:
阅读排行:
· TypeScript + Deepseek 打造卜卦网站:技术与玄学的结合
· Manus的开源复刻OpenManus初探
· .NET Core 中如何实现缓存的预热?
· 阿里巴巴 QwQ-32B真的超越了 DeepSeek R-1吗?
· 如何调用 DeepSeek 的自然语言处理 API 接口并集成到在线客服系统
点击右上角即可分享
微信分享提示